MalayTranslate.com
Malay to English Translator
Translate Here

Malay to English

hasil carian: sumber utama

Probably related to:
Malay English
sumber utama
a chief resource, a major source of, a major source, main source of, main source, major source, the main source of, the main sources, the major source, the principal sources,